A survey regarding opening up a cannabis shop in Brant County is now coming to a close.
BRANT COUNTY - The County of Brant wants the public's input as to whether or not they want a cannabis retail store.
The decision must be made by January 22, 2019 on allowing a cannabis store into the county of Brant.
